#53204e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53204e is composed of 32.5% red, 12.5%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 6%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 305.9 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 22.5%. #53204e color hex could be obtained by blending #a6409c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#53204e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53204e has RGB values of R:83, G:32,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.06,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5447758.

Shades and Tints of #53204e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c050b is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#53204e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d363c is the less saturated color, while #720167 is the most saturated one.
